    Spent 2 nights at the lodge. Seems to be a small family run business. Room was clean and very…read moresmall. Grounds felt safe. Literally there's a queen bed and one person walking space on either side of the bed. No storage space nor closet. One sitting chair. Tiny bathroom and shower. Felt like an RV more so than a motel room....too cramped. $165/night....mehhhh. Location is great for dip netting. The check in guy was so lack luster. He didn't exhibit the type of hospitality I felt characteristic of places that charge that much for a closet space. Staff did respond quickly to requests and check out guy was warmer than the initial guy. They have some $250/night cabins shoved onto the parking lot and tightly packed RV lot. I guess I'd say...bravo on maximizing every square inch to make $$$! I would definitely look for a more spacious spot next time I'm in the area. I like to be able to stretch my arms and legs without hitting a wall.

    Happy with our selection! A friend and I were traveling and it was the cheapest selection in Kenai…read more We stayed in the main lodging for $120 a night. It was very clean and cozy. There is a bathroom, small fridge and queen bed. The views are amazing. It may be less crowded because dip net season just ended a few days ago but we didn't feel overcrowded. I don't know why everyone is complaining, it lists what you get for the price online. The owners are the quiet type but were very accommodating. I wouldn't say it's a 5 star hotel but it was 5 stars in that it offered what it advertised, was clean and comfortable. It seems like most of the complaints are from the RV park users. If you're a mature adult and enjoy a quiet camp with a beautiful view I think you'd be happy here. It's not a 20's something party spot.
